Jasper has crossed from AI writing assistant to enterprise multi-agent marketing platform. The company doubled enterprise revenue and grew to 850+ enterprise clients, shipping Marketing Workflow Automation and 80+ AI Apps as its central strategic move. Subsequent releases have focused on the governance infrastructure enterprises need to deploy AI at scale: Governed Product Truth keeps brand and product information consistent across integrations; an AI image suite with new Flux ControlNet models matures in parallel; Audiences brings audience profile intelligence into campaign creation.
Jasper is building the control layer that large marketing organizations need before they can fully automate output: brand voice enforcement, product truth governance, audience segmentation, and workflow orchestration. The trajectory leads toward Jasper as the orchestration platform for the full marketing production stack — brief, audience definition, copy generation, image creation, and multi-channel distribution — all within governed guardrails that keep output brand-consistent.
The next move is likely deeper integration with distribution channels (social, email platforms, paid advertising) so that Jasper-generated campaigns can execute end-to-end without manual handoffs. An enterprise-grade approval workflow or compliance layer would follow naturally as a gating mechanism.
Userpilot has launched an MCP server that exposes its product context—feature adoption rates, friction points, cohort behavior—directly to AI coding tools and agents. In the same week, session replay gained automatic friction and error detection, reducing the analysis burden from manual review. Together these two July 2026 releases push the product toward surfacing insights automatically rather than requiring analysts to go looking.
The pattern across recent releases is toward intelligent automation: session replay that flags errors without manual review, multi-channel workflow orchestration from a single builder, and now MCP that feeds product data into AI agents. Userpilot is repositioning from 'add in-app guides' to 'orchestrate the full product-led growth loop'—with AI doing the interpretation layer.
Expect more AI-mediated analysis features: automated insight generation, AI-drafted in-app messages based on behavior patterns, and deeper CRM integrations. The MCP release positions Userpilot to compete on intelligence against Pendo and Gainsight rather than purely on tooling breadth.
